British Airways (BA) is the United Kingdom’s flag carrier airline with headquarters in London near its main hub at London Heathrow Airport (LHR). BA is the second largest UK-based airline in terms of fleet size and number of passengers carried. Known as a full-service global airline, British Airways offers year-round low fares to destinations worldwide and flies to and from centrally-located airports. Its extensive global route network includes more than 170 destinations in nearly 80 countries throughout Europe, North America, South America, Asia, Africa and Australia.

There are plenty of options for travelling from London to Hanover. The journey between London and Hanover is 424 miles and takes around one and half hours by plane. Flights depart from several airports in London, including London Heathrow Airport (LHR) and London City Airport (LCY), and all flights arrive at Langenhagen Airport (HAJ) in Hanover. There are generally four direct flights per day and over thirty indirect routes to choose from.
Eurowings and British Airways fly the direct route from London to Hanover. Air France, KLM and Brussels Airlines are among the many airlines that operate indirect flights between the two cities.
Direct flights from London to Hanover take one and a half hours. For flight routes with a change, expect an extra hour of flying time, plus the airport layover time. These routes require a change of planes in other countries, including France, The Netherlands and Belgium.
There usually around four direct flights from London to Hanover per day from Sunday to Friday and two per day on Saturday. Flights generally depart once in the morning, once in the evening and twice at night. Indirect flights take a number of different routes and there are upwards of 30 available per day.
Flights from London to Hanover generally leave from London Heathrow Airport and arrive in Hannover Airport.
London Heathrow Airport is 27.3 km away from London city centre and Hannover Airport is 13.8 km from Hanover city centre.
